What Year Was Irene Ryan Born
Irene Ryan was born on October 16, 1902, in El Paso, Texas. She later became a well-known American actress and comedian, best remembered for her role as Daisy May on The Beverly Hillbillies. Her birth year is consistently documented in major entertainment reference sources and public records.

Irene Ryan Career Highlights and Financial Legacy
Ryan built a long career in film and television, appearing in numerous productions from the 1930s through the 1970s. Her most famous role came in the 1960s sitcom The Beverly Hillbillies, which aired on CBS and became one of the highest-rated series of its era.
